Webb25 juli 2024 · Whale sharks can dive more than a kilometre deep and they migrate to the waters of neighbouring countries, thousands of kilometres of away. Understanding these behaviours is critical to the future of the species. In order to ensure their survival we need to know what attracts these sharks to Ningaloo and where they go when they leave. WebbLocal sharks actually do not migrate. They tend to keep within around 100 miles (or 160 kilometers) of the geographic center.
